@RudeAnimat0r Will people buy the new IP? 'Cause last time i check, Insomniac created plenty of new IP before focusing on Marvel IP but most of them either a flop or pretty much forgotten by most people.
Like Sunset Overdrive for example which was a big flop and only made them $567 bucks.
https://www.levelup.com/en/news/insomniac-only-earned-567-usd-with-sunset-overdrive-an-xbox-exclusive/
Another big flop was Fuse under EA. Then there's some small and VR games that almost no one gives a damn anymore like Song of the Deep, Stormland, Edge of Nowhere, The Unspoken etc etc.
Even Resistance series wasn't sold that good with the last two final games Resistance 3 and Burning Skies ended as a commercial flop, despite the IP keeps being requested by some people in here.
In the end, Insomniac best and popular IP's are only Spyro which now owned by MS and Ratchet. But Ratchet has been squeezed pretty hard with 16-17 games (+1 Ranger Rumble still in development) in the span of two decades.
So...for now i think Insomniac did the right thing on focusing at Marvel properties and Ratchet once in a blue moon.
